Test Overview & Methodology

The PSA Free Test quantifies unbound prostate-specific antigen in serum, serving as a critical adjunct to total PSA for stratifying prostate cancer risk — particularly in men with total PSA levels between 4–10 ng/mL where the free-to-total ratio refines biopsy decision-making. This assay is performed using Chemiluminescent Microparticle Immunoassay (CMIA) on ISO 9001:2015 accredited platforms.

Physician Insight & Safety Protocols

A Note from Mr. Prabhakar Reddy Kalathoor (DHA Registration ID: 61713011, Specialist Diagnostic Radiology):

The PSA Free Test is a powerful risk-stratification tool, but it must always be interpreted alongside total PSA, digital rectal examination findings, and patient age — never in isolation. I urge every patient to understand that a single elevated value does not confirm malignancy, nor does a normal result fully exclude it; clinical correlation with a DHA-licensed specialist is essential.

This test is most clinically useful when the total PSA is in the diagnostic gray zone of 4–10 ng/mL, where a free PSA percentage below 10% significantly elevates the probability of detecting clinically significant prostate cancer on biopsy.

Medication Advisory

⚠ Important: Do not discontinue any prescribed medication — including 5-alpha reductase inhibitors (e.g., finasteride, dutasteride), anti-androgens, or hormonal therapies — without consulting your prescribing physician. These medications directly influence PSA levels, and abrupt cessation can confound clinical interpretation. Always inform your healthcare provider of all medications before testing.

Exclusion Criteria & Emergency Red Flags

Exclusion Criteria — Do NOT proceed with sample collection if:

  • Digital Rectal Examination (DRE) performed within the last 7 days.
  • Rectal prostatic ultrasonography performed within the last 7 days.
  • Active urinary tract infection (UTI) or acute prostatitis — wait at least 4–6 weeks post-resolution.
  • Prostate biopsy within the last 6 weeks.
  • Ejaculation within 48 hours prior to blood draw.

Emergency Red Flags — Seek immediate medical attention if:

  • Acute urinary retention or complete inability to urinate.
  • Visible blood in urine (frank hematuria) with clots.
  • Sudden onset severe lower back, pelvic, or perineal pain.
  • Unexplained rapid weight loss exceeding 5 kg in 4 weeks with bone pain.
  • New-onset lower extremity weakness or bowel/bladder incontinence.

Patient FAQ & Clinical Guidance

1. What does the PSA Free Test tell me that a standard total PSA test does not?

The free PSA fraction helps distinguish benign prostate enlargement from malignancy when total PSA falls between 4 and 10 ng/mL. A lower free PSA percentage — particularly below 10% — correlates with a higher probability of detecting clinically significant prostate cancer upon biopsy, while a percentage above 25% more strongly suggests ben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H). This differentiation reduces unnecessary biopsies by approximately 20–30% in appropriately selected patients.

2. Why must I wait 7 days after a digital rectal examination before giving a blood sample?

Digital rectal examination and rectal prostatic ultrasonography mechanically manipulate the prostate gland, causing a transient release of PSA into the bloodstream that can falsely elevate results by up to 30–50%. Waiting a full 7 days ensures that any iatrogenic PSA spike has cleared, yielding a result that accurately reflects your baseline prostatic physiology rather than procedural artifact.
